| def find_mod(module_name: str) -> str | None | importlib.abc.Loader: |
| """ |
| Find module `module_name` on sys.path, and return the path to module `module_name`. |
| |
| * If `module_name` refers to a module directory, then return path to `__init__` file. |
| * If `module_name` is a directory without an __init__file, return None. |
| |
| * If module is missing or does not have a `.py` or `.pyw` extension, return None. |
| * Note that we are not interested in running bytecode. |
| |
| * Otherwise, return the fill path of the module. |
| |
| Parameters |
| ---------- |
| module_name : str |
| |
| Returns |
| ------- |
| module_path : str |
| Path to module `module_name`, its __init__.py, or None, |
| depending on above conditions. |
| """ |
| spec = importlib.util.find_spec(module_name) |
| if spec is None: |
| return None |
| module_path = spec.origin |
| if module_path is None: |
| if spec.loader is not None and spec.loader in sys.meta_path: |
| return spec.loader |
| return None |
| else: |
| split_path = module_path.split(".") |
| if split_path[-1] in ["py", "pyw"]: |
| return module_path |
| else: |
| return None |
